to make enough or more revenue and profit. With the same setting (filming setting, costumes, especially those cost a lot for costume drama), salary for famous actors, the more episodes, the more revenue (copywright, ads etc). Short drama with ~ 1x episodes or less normally have very low budget and recuits young, unpopular actors. No famous actors want to participate in short drama since it is considered as degradation of their status
